"The animation shows the flora and fauna of the lake and the land and teaches that the world is made of differences."05 September 1983Animated, Family, TV Movie72 mins
This is the story of the water spider, which, unlike land spiders, does not weave its web in the corners of rooms or in the tops of trees or bushes, but in the water.
